Formal Merry Christmas Greetings

Formal greetings are ideal for professional relationships, elderly recipients, or when you want to showcase a more traditional tone. Here are some examples of formal ways to say Merry Christmas on a card:

1. Wishing you a joyous Christmas season and a prosperous New Year.

2. Sending warm Christmas wishes your way.

3. May your holidays be filled with love, laughter, and cherished moments.

4. Wishing you and your loved ones a Merry Christmas filled with peace and happiness.

5. May this festive season bring you blessings and good tidings.

Informal Merry Christmas Greetings

For friends, family members, and close colleagues, adding a more personal touch to your Christmas card is often preferred. Here are some examples of informal ways to express Merry Christmas:

1. Cheers to a wonderful Christmas filled with love and laughter!

2. Wishing you all the love and joy this Christmas and throughout the coming year.

3. May your holiday season be sprinkled with lots of happiness and good times.

4. Sending warm and fuzzy Christmas wishes your way.

5. Merry Christmas! May your days be merry and bright.

Tips for Writing a Meaningful Christmas Card

To make your Christmas card stand out and touch the recipient’s heart, keep these tips in mind:

  1. Be personal: Mention specific memories or inside jokes to make your card more intimate.
  2. Use heartfelt language: Express your feelings genuinely, showing love, appreciation, and warm wishes.
  3. Add a personal touch: Consider including a hand-drawn picture, a photo, or a small gift to make the card extra special.
  4. Mention your recipient’s interests: Show that you know and care about their hobbies and passions.
  5. Keep it concise: Make sure your message is clear and concise, as a long card may become overwhelming to read.
